    since you have no corals or livestock, i would start that tank over personally. nuke the whole thing and redo. sounds like the person who owned the tank previously didnt have the time to care for it and when he told you everything in there is dead, that would put up some warning signs in my head to not keep anything he had going.

    bleach rock clean the sand and add newly mixed saltwater and let it cycle for several weeks.
